Genesis 36:6 And Esau took his wives, and his sons, and his daughters, and all the persons of his house, and his cattle, and all his beasts, and all his substance, which he had got in the land of Canaan; and went into the country from the face of his brother Jacob. 7 For their riches were more than that they might dwell together; and the land wherein they were strangers could not bear them because of their cattle.
Both Esau and Jacob have been living in the land of Canaan. They separate because they just have too much money, too many animals to be able to live close to each other. The cattle need too much space to get enough to eat.
So Esau will go one way and Jacob will go another. They will form two large families and kingdoms. Esau, also called Edom, will go to Seir. Jacob and Esau will never really get along after all that has happened.
